2025 Compare Cities Education:
Nashua, NH vs Mishawaka, IN

Change Cities
Highlights
- Mishawaka spends 24.7% less per student than Nashua.
- The Student Teacher Ratio is 25.2% higher in Mishawaka than in Nashua. (lower means fewer students in each classroom).
- Mishawaka had 1.0% fewer residents who had graduated High School compared to Nashua
